Ulixes Silver Pendant – The Strategist, Survivor, and Endless Journey
The Ulixes silver pendant is a powerful contemporary interpretation of one of the most complex heroes of classical antiquity. Ulixes—known in Greek as Odysseus—was the legendary king of Ithaca, a master strategist of the Trojan War and the central figure of Homer’s Odyssey. He symbolized intelligence, adaptability, and survival through wit rather than brute force. Ulixes was not the strongest of heroes, but the most enduring—defined by his long journey, moral ambiguity, and relentless will to return home.
This pendant depicts a human skull wearing a French Adrian helmet, the iconic military helmet of the early 20th century. The helmet evokes modern warfare, mass mobilization, and the transformation of individual soldiers into anonymous participants in history’s conflicts. The skull, a universal symbol of mortality, underscores the inevitable cost of war, time, and experience.
